S-Methoprene
CAS No. 65733-16-6
S-Methoprene ( Preco; (+)-Methoprene; ZR 2458; ZR2458; ZR-2458 )
Catalog No. M27149 CAS No. 65733-16-6
S-Methoprene is an analog of juvenile hormone and can be used as an insecticide. S-Methoprene alters redox activity of cytochrome oxidase and induces male sex differentiation.
